Today, August 25, the Prime Minister of Norway Jonas Gahr Støre arrived in Ukraine. Talks with President Volodymyr Zelenskyy are planned.
The Minister of Foreign Affairs of Ukraine Andrii Sybiha has announced this on X.
Today in the morning, together with @AndriyYermak, we met Prime Minister @jonasgahrstore at the Kyiv train station. Norway is one of our closest allies. Prime Minister’s visit for talks with President @ZelenskyyUa is a strong sign of solidarity and support for our people. pic.twitter.com/fZ31MtQ7OZ

As the Ukrainian News agency earlier reported, on the morning of May 20, Crown Prince Regent Haakon of Norway arrived in Kyiv for the first time on an official visit. His plans included meeting with the authorities and visiting wounded servicemen in hospital.
